When we chose to believe in the death and resurrection of Jesus Christ we were reconciled to our Heavenly Father.  We were born again from above into the family of God and given the will and the desire to live a life of moral excellence that is pleasing to God.  We inherited a divine nature and became children of God who have a place in God’s kingdom.  

Jesus answered: I tell you for certain that before you can get into God’s kingdom, you must be born not only by water, but by the Spirit. Humans give life to their children. Yet only God’s Spirit can change you into a child of God.   (John 3:5-6 CEV)

We were helpless to do anything for ourselves when we were new-born babies in our human family. We relied on our parents or caregivers and teachers to help us grow and mature so we could live effectively in this world.  It’s much the same when we are born again into the Kingdom of God.  We are helpless on our own and need to rely on our gracious God to help us grow and mature so we can live effectively in the Kingdom of God. 


I am writing this to you, my children, so that you will not sin; but if anyone does sin, we have someone who pleads with the Father on our behalf—Jesus Christ, the righteous one. (1 John 2:1 GNT) 
In the past, we chose to live by what was right in our own eyes and eventually ended up in an unmanageable existence which we were powerless to change.  Now, as we seek God and practice His principles in all our affairs, the guidance and strength we need to move forward into a life of moral excellence will be there for us.  Moral excellence may not happen overnight but, as we persevere, we will be active and effective for the Kingdom of God.

Do your best to improve your faith. You can do this by adding goodness, understanding, self-control, patience, devotion to God, concern for others, and love.  (2 Peter 1:5-7 CEV)

Prayer:  Lord Jesus, Thank You for all You have done, and continue to do for me.  Help me to live a life of moral excellence and to carry the message to everyone I meet.  Amen
